def solve():
    """X = number of colors present
    X = X1 + X2 + ... + X7, where
    Xi = 1 if color i present else 0

    EX = E(X1 + X2 + ... X6)
    EX = EX1 + EX2 + ... + EX6
    EX = 7 * EX1

    EX = 7 * (1 * p(color present))
    EX = 7 * (1 - p(color absent))
    EX = 7 * (1 - #(colors absent) / #(possibilities))
    EX = 7 * (1 - 60 choose 20 / 70 choose 20)
    """
    return round(7 * (1 - choose(60, 20) / choose(70, 20)), 10)
